31 January 2005 The variation of spectral response of transmission-type GaAs photocathode in the seal process
Author Affiliations +
Abstract
In this paper, firstly the spectral response of transmission-type GaAs photocathode is measured online by the spectral response-testing instrument. Then the cathode is sealed in the third generation intensifier and put into the instrument again to get another spectral response curve. The variation of spectral response curves was compared. The results show that through the seal process, the spectral response in the long wavelength decrease. Based on these curves, the spectral matching factors of GaAs photocathode for green vegetation and rough concrete are calculated. The calculated performance parameters show that the variation of the spectral response in the seal process is an important influence factor on the performance of the intensifier in the use of night vision.
